A Better Back Chiropractic Center Presents: Headaches
Studies have shown that roughly a third of all people suffer from headaches. The causes of headaches are many; they include such things as spinal misalignment, certain foods, toxic fumes, preservatives and alcohol. Spinal misalignments (subluxations) are shown to be involved in up to 80% of all headaches.

Medical volunteers needed for 2017 Commonwealth Youth Games
The 2017 Commonwealth Youth Games (CYG) in The Bahamas will feature about 1,300 athletes from the participating member countries of the Commonwealth Games Federation (CGF), which means that there will be a need for local medical officers to step forward and volunteer their services.
